
FOOD PROGRAMME
When children are hungry, it’s difficult to concentrate and learn. Many Adelaide Primary students come from households facing financial hardship and food insecurity.
Our Food Programme provides healthy meals every school day, supporting attendance and removing one of the biggest obstacles to learning.


How We Help
We operate a kitchen at the school and employ a full‑time chef and assistant to prepare fresh meals for every student, every day.
On-Site Kitchen & Staff
Healthy, Balanced Meals
Students receive fresh, high-quality breakfasts and lunches that keep them nourished, energised and ready to learn.
Nutrition-Focused Menus
Our menus meet students’ nutritional needs, reflect their preferences, and encourage healthy eating habits.
Meet The People
Our dedicated chef, Evelyn Knowles, and her assistant, Dedrie Thompson, ensure that every meal is healthy, balanced and full of flavour.
Kind and welcoming, they know every child by name and greet them with a smile.
No child goes hungry in the Auxiliary's kitchen, and Evelyn’s pasta bolognese is legendary!
Our Food Programme is overseen by the Auxiliary's Cassandra Price, who keeps everything running smoothly.
